Output 7826fc83e6bbf0852e44b7b514928a86705c39e131c16ab2cbe0ce60e1790f66:0

value
66090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de404d9752edc837f96bc9c249991347cc392bd2 OP_EQUALVERIFY OP_CHECKSIG
address
1MGA3Sia5tvcvz1JrYt2Jc9hAqVQ4SJjQi
transaction
7826fc83e6bbf0852e44b7b514928a86705c39e131c16ab2cbe0ce60e1790f66
spent
true